EV-pembro in localised and advanced bladder cancer - a superb summary! 24.06.2026 32:44
All you need to know about enfortumab vedotin (EV) & pembro in bladder cancer in 25 minutes! We are joined in studio by bladder cancer gurus Shilpa Gupta (Cleveland Clinic, USA) and Andrew Weickhardt (Austin Health, AUS) to get an update on the role of EV-pembro in both muscle-invasive localised bladder cancer, and metastatic bladder cancer. Journal club #8 | PROTECT and EV-301 13.06.2026 22:35
Welcome to Episode 8 of our monthly GU Cast Journal Club! Today we focus on two very important papers in localised prostate cancer and metastatic bladder cancer. The landmark 15 year update of the PROTECT trial, published in NEJM in 2023, and the breakthrough EV-301 trial which heralded enfortumab vedotin in progressive metastatic bladder cancer, published in NEJM in 2021. Is Copper the new Gold??! Co-PSMA trial in European Urology 23.04.2026 27:25
Now this is an interesting one, a new PSMA tracer which appears to greatly outperform 68Ga-PSMA-11 for biochemical recurrence. We discuss 64Cu-SAR-bisPSMA with Professor Louise Emmett (Nuclear Medicine Physician, Sydney), and Dr Matt Roberts (Urologist, Brisbane), which they compared head to head with trusty old 68Ga-PSMA-11 in the Co-PSMA trial, just published in European Urology. ASPIRE-ing to answer the Triplet question! With Rana McKay and Deepak Kilari 02.04.2026 25:11
The trial they said would never be done! Huge congrats to the Alliance for Clinical Trials in Oncology who have recently opened the ASPIRE trial, a phase III randomised trial of ADT + apalutamide (doublet), vs ADT + apalutamide + docetaxel chemotherapy (triplet) for men with mHSPC. 1200 men will be recruited from more than 300 sites across the US with many sites already open and recruiting. Journal Club #5 | Lamm BCG maintenance and CHAARTED 09.01.2026 30:52
Happy New Year and welcome to Episode 5 of our monthly GU Cast Journal Club! Today we focus on two classic papers in non-invasive bladder cancer and metastatic prostate cancer. The Lamm RCT of maintenance BCG is a landmark trial for all sorts of reasons, published in J Urol in 2000. Journal Club #4 | PRECISION and EB-StaR 30.11.2025 32:27
Episode 4 of our monthly GU Cast Journal Club and today we focus on two important papers in prostate cancer diagnostics and bladder cancer surgery. The PRECISION NEJM paper 2018 is a landmark publication which defined the role of mpMRI in early detection, and changed practice in many countries.
